       Ok here’s my plan for mass adoption of decentralized mesh internet:Before I get to the plan, we need to address the elephant in the room.We’re basically starting the internet over.It’s going to be a lot slower than what we have right now.The masses won’t adopt something until they can play games and watch Netflix on it.We’re not there yet, so the masses won’t adopt it.Now to eat the elephant:We need to approach from a different aspect — safety in case of catastrophe.We need to get a mesh relay in every home as a “backup” in case of natural disaster or other catastrophe.No need to even bring up the goal of total decentralization of the internet.The masses don’t “get” that.Different people will have different concerns in this, so we will need to learn who we’re talking to.“Know your audience” as the comedians would say.“Preppers” are an easy bunch to sell — just play to their paranoia. They need a mesh network in case the internet goes down. Some preppers are afraid of the government, you can take that aspect. Most seem to be fairly conservative in politics so going from the “corporations are bad” aspect won’t work. The best bet is to play to their fear of national collapse...that’s what they’re most afraid of.And again, approaching from the catastrophe protection aspect is the only way we’re going to get these into every home.Pick natural disasters in any specific area when talking to people in that area.When Florida gets wrecked by hurricanes, we often go days to weeks without power, which means no internet.We all have smartphones but when everyone in an area hops on their phones at the same time to stream Netflix, the network gets bogged down.Some people are just trying to send a message to a neighbor...those are the people local mesh networks are for.Tornado alley: tornados knock out power.Earthquake areas...also easy.The main thing is: if we can get mesh networks into more homes than less, positioned as a “backup in case of national disaster or other catastrophe,” it’s going to be much easier to get mass adoption moved from the centralized corp+gov internet and moved over to a mesh network.It’s going to take a long time. This is not an overnight solution. There is no overnight solution.
